Why adopt a LinkedIn Newsletter in B2B?

A direct channel to engage a targeted audience

The LinkedIn Newsletter allows you to communicate directly with a qualified audience. Unlike traditional publications, this format ensures your subscribers receive your content via notifications on their smartphones and by email. This significantly increases your chances of being read and engaging your audience .

Tip: Identify the specific needs of your target audience to create content that captures their attention and meets their expectations.

With a well-thought-out strategy, you can transform your subscribers into brand ambassadors. This direct link fosters authentic and regular interaction, essential for building trust in the B2B sector.

A powerful alternative to traditional publications

Traditional LinkedIn posts are often lost in the information stream. In contrast, a LinkedIn Newsletter offers a dedicated space to share rich and in-depth content. This format stands out for its ability to generate measurable results:

  • A LinkedIn newsletter converts between 10 and 15% of subscribers into followers within the first 24 hours.

  • Each new edit triggers a notification, increasing the visibility of your content.

By adopting this format, you maximize the impact of your marketing efforts while standing out in a saturated digital environment.

Optimize and measure the performance of your LinkedIn newsletter

Monitor key indicators: open rates, clicks, conversions

To evaluate the effectiveness of your LinkedIn newsletter, you need to track key indicators. These metrics allow you to understand how your audience interacts with your content and adjust your strategy accordingly.

Indicator

Recommended value

Open rate

21% to 28%

Click-through rate

2% to 5%

Conversion rate

1% to 3%

  • Open rate : This measures the appeal of your newsletter's subject line. A high rate indicates that your subject line captures attention.

  • Click-through rate : This metric reflects interest in the content. It shows whether your readers find your information relevant.

  • Conversion rate : It evaluates actions taken, such as a registration or a purchase.

Tip: Test different headlines and calls to action to improve these metrics.

FAQ: LinkedIn Newsletter

How to create a LinkedIn newsletter?

To create a newsletter, make sure you have at least 150 connections on LinkedIn. Go to your profile, click on “Create a newsletter,” and follow the steps. Choose a catchy title and relevant content to attract subscribers.

What are the advantages of a LinkedIn newsletter?

Newsletters improve your visibility, reinforce your expertise, and build audience loyalty. They allow you to reach a qualified target audience through notifications and SEO optimization. This helps you stand out in a competitive market.

How can I measure the performance of my newsletter?

Track key metrics such as open rate, click-through rate, and conversion rate. Use LinkedIn analytics to analyze this data and adjust your strategy based on the results.
